Jaguar is the latest manufacturer to join the fast estate club with the XFR-S Sportbrake and to be honest, it’s taken them long enough! Whilst it may have taken some time to match their rivals in this category, our first impressions would suggest that it’s been worth the wait. The engine, which is the same 542bhp 5.0-litre that you get in the XFR-S saloon will do 0-62 in just 4.8 seconds – pretty impressive by anyone’s standards.
The first reports are that the XFR-S Sportbrake is a powerful machine and one that is sensitive on the accelerator pedal, providing plenty of engine-roar and fun. To cope with the power increase they have increased the stiffness of the body by 30%. Other features include an 8-speed gear box and corner recognition.
Looks-wise, it doesn’t disappoint with 20-inch alloys, deep front bumpers and side and central air intakes all adding to its sporty image. This power and looks, combined with the fact that it still has 550 litres of boot space is a power combination in itself.
